Understanding Google’s Featured Snippets

Before we delve into the intricacies of earning a place in Google’s featured snippets, it’s crucial to grasp what these snippets are and how they function.

Different Types of Featured Snippets

There are primarily three types of featured snippets:

  1. Paragraph snippets: The most common type, these snippets provide direct answers to user queries in a concise paragraph.
  2. List snippets: These snippets present information in the form of a numbered list or bulleted list. They’re particularly prevalent for posts detailing steps, tips, or methods.
  3. Table snippets: These snippets display data from a page that would be best shown in a table. They are usually used for posts that compare or list numerical data.

As of 2023, paragraph snippets constitute approximately 82% of the featured snippets, followed by list snippets at 10.8% and table snippets at 7.2%.

How Google Chooses Content for Featured Snippets

Google’s algorithm selects the best answer to a user’s question from pages already indexed, considering factors such as content relevance, page authority, and clarity of the information provided. As per a 2022 study, pages ranking in the top 10 of Google’s search results are more likely to be featured in snippets, with around 99.58% being pulled from these top-ranking pages.

Advanced SEO Techniques for Earning Featured Snippets

Earning featured snippets isn’t just about creating quality content; it’s also about structuring and optimizing that content in ways that align with Google’s algorithm. Here are some advanced SEO techniques that can enhance your chances of securing these valuable search results spots.

Keyword Research and Optimization

The cornerstone of any SEO strategy is effective keyword research and optimization. It’s particularly relevant when aiming for featured snippets.

  1. Importance of long-tail keywords: Long-tail keywords are phrases that are more specific and usually longer than commonly used. They are instrumental in driving quality traffic to your site because they align more with the user’s intent. A study from Ahrefs in 2022 showed that almost 70% of searches are made up of long-tail keywords, making them a crucial aspect of targeting featured snippets.
  2. How to find and use relevant keywords: You can utilize SEO tools such as SEMRush, Ahrefs, and Google Keyword Planner to identify relevant long-tail keywords. Once you’ve identified these keywords, incorporate them naturally into your content, especially in your headings and subheadings, as Google often pulls featured snippets from these areas.

Schema Markup

Schema markup is a form of microdata that helps Google understand your content better.

  1. Understanding schema markup: It’s a code you put on your website to help search engines provide more informative results to users. By clarifying your content to Google, you increase your chances of earning a featured snippet.
  2. Benefits of using schema markup: According to a 2023 study by Schema.org, websites using schema markup rank four positions higher in search results than those without it.
  3. How to apply schema markup to your site: You can use several types of schema markups, such as FAQ schema or HowTo schema, depending on your content’s nature. Tools like Google’s Structured Data Markup Helper can guide you in generating appropriate schema markups for your site.

On-Page SEO Techniques

  1. Use of headings and subheadings: Structuring your content with clear, keyword-optimized headings and subheadings can improve your chances of earning a featured snippet. A 2023 study by Backlinko found that 36% of featured snippets are pulled from content structured with H2 and H3 tags.
  2. Writing concise and informative meta descriptions: While meta descriptions don’t directly impact your SEO rankings, a well-written meta description can boost your content’s relevancy, improving its chances of being featured in a snippet.

High-Quality Content Creation

  1. Importance of original, well-researched content: Google prioritizes unique, high-quality content for featured snippets. The better researched and more comprehensive your content, the higher the likelihood of it being featured.
  2. Making content easy to read and understand: Simple, easy-to-understand language is critical to being featured. A 2022 study by SEMrush showed that pages written at a 9th-grade reading level or below are more likely to earn a featured snippet.
  3. Structuring content for featured snippets: Structure your content accordingly depending on the type of snippet you’re aiming for. For example, use bullet points or numbered lists for list snippets, especially when explaining steps or presenting a list of items.

Creating Q&A Pages and FAQ Sections

  1. How Q&A pages and FAQ sections improve your chances of earning snippets: Q&A and FAQ sections directly answer user questions, making them prime candidates for featured snippets. A 2023 Moz study showed that almost 30% of featured snippets are taken from Q&A pages or FAQ sections.
  2. Tips for crafting effective Q&As and FAQs: Ensure your questions are keyword-optimized and address common user queries directly. The answers should be concise, clear, and placed close to the questions for better recognition by Google’s algorithm.

Monitoring and Adjusting Your SEO Strategy

Earning a featured snippet is not a one-time achievement but an ongoing effort that requires regular monitoring and adjustment of your SEO strategies. Here are some important considerations:

Regularly Reviewing Your Snippets Performance

It’s vital to regularly monitor which of your pages have earned featured snippets and analyze what’s working well. Google Search Console is a valuable tool for this purpose. A 2023 report by HubSpot found that websites that performed monthly audits and made necessary adjustments based on their results had a 20% higher chance of retaining featured snippets.

Understanding and Utilizing Google Search Console

Google Search Console is a free tool offered by Google that helps you monitor, maintain, and troubleshoot your site’s presence in Google Search results.

  1. Performance report: This report helps you to track how often your site appears in Google searches, which queries show your site, and how these data trends change over time. According to a 2022 study by SEOClarity, using this data to identify and improve underperforming pages increased the likelihood of earning a featured snippet by 17%.
  2. Enhancements report: This report provides insights about your site’s usability, such as mobile usability issues, which can indirectly affect your chances of earning a featured snippet.
  3. Index coverage report: This report helps you understand which of your pages have been indexed and troubleshoot any issues.

Adjusting Strategies Based on Data and Results

SEO is a dynamic field, with Google constantly updating its algorithm. Therefore, what works today might not work tomorrow. SEO strategies should be adjusted based on performance data, changing algorithms, and evolving user behavior. For instance, if a specific type of content consistently earns featured snippets, focus on creating more of that content.
